Class VectorIcons


  • public class VectorIcons
    extends java.lang.Object

    Represents a source of VectorIcon instances. This class is made to be used with a json source file which stores the source of the vector icons. The json format is expected to be an array of objects, each object containing "name" and "paths".

    "name" is a string, the name/key of the icon. "paths" is an array of one or more strings. The strings must conform to the "d" attribute rules of an SVG path, see https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/SVG/Attribute/d for reference.

    This class also contains static accessors for a static instance of VectorIcons for all of the icons that are part of the Ignition platform itself.

    • Method Detail

      • createFromJson

        public static VectorIcons createFromJson​(java.io.Reader json)
        Create a new instance of VectorIcons from a reader. Once created, use getIcon(String) or getInteractive(String) to retrieve a specific icon from the supplied JSON.

        Supply an icon named error to use a custom fallback icon (should an invalid name be provided) - if no error icon is provided, a default will be used.

      • get

        public static VectorIcon get​(java.lang.String name,
                                     java.awt.Color color)
        Fetch an icon of the given name from the built-in icon source.
        Parameters:
        name - Name of the icon
        color - Color to use as fill
